The conflict of the faculties -- The debate on research in the arts -- Artistic research and academia : an uneasy relationship -- Artistic research within the fields of science -- Where are we today? The state of art in artistic research -- Artistic research as boundary work -- The production of knowledge in artistic research -- Boundary work : an interview -- Artistic practices and epistemic things -- Ingredients for the assessment of artistic research -- The case of the journal for artistic research.

"In this emerging field of research, artistic practices contribute as research to what we know and understand, and academia opens its mind to forms of knowledge and understanding that are entwined with artistic practices. Henk Borgdorff also addresses how we speak about such issues, and how the things we say cause the practices involved to manifest themselves in specific ways, while also setting them into motion. In this sense, this work not only explores the phenomenon of artistic research in relation to academia, but it also engages with that relationship. This performative dimension of the book is interwoven with its constative and interpretive dimensions. Borgdorff's aim is not only to advance knowledge and understanding of artistic research, but to further the development of this emerging field."--Book jacket.
